Overview Rubiquin 100mg Tablet
Malarex 100mg tablets combat parasitic infections, primarily malaria. They also offer relief from nocturnal leg cramps. This medication eradicates the malaria parasite, halting infection progression. Dosage and treatment length should strictly adhere to your physician's instructions. Ingestion with food minimizes potential stomach discomfort. Complete the prescribed course, even with symptom improvement; avoid missed doses. Employ mosquito repellents to minimize exposure. Side effects, such as nausea, headache, and vertigo, may occur; persistent symptoms warrant medical attention. Pre-existing conditions like seizures, kidney, heart, or liver issues, should be disclosed to your doctor. Diabetics should report their condition as Malarex 100mg can influence blood glucose levels, requiring regular monitoring. Blurred vision is a potential effect, necessitating routine eye exams during treatment. Prolonged use may necessitate regular blood cell count monitoring. Report any unusual bruising, bleeding, sore throat, fever, or fatigue to your doctor immediately.

Common Side effects of Rubiquin 100mg Tablet:
- Vomiting
- Deafness
- Headache
- Dizziness
- Flushing (sense of warmth in the face, ears, neck and trunk)
- Blurred vision
- Nausea
- Abdominal pain
- Ringing in ear
- Diarrhea
- Vertigo
- Increased sweating

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Alcohol consumption alongside Rubiquin 100mg Tablets may pose unknown risks.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Rubiquin 100m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Based on limited available data in breastfeeding mothers, the use of Rubiquin 100mg tablets appears to pose a negligible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by Rubiquin 100mg Tablets, which can induce visual disturbances and vertigo (a sensation of dizziness or spinning).
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Rubiquin 100m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with hepatic impairment should use Rubiquin 100mg tablets cautiously. Dosage modification may be necessary for these patients. Physician consultation is advised.
